Lon A. Jenkins
About Lon A. Jenkins
Lon A. Jenkins is a lawyer based in Salt Lake City, UT and has been recognized in The Best Lawyers in America® since 2007. Lon A. Jenkins is recognized in the following practice areas:
- Salt Lake City, Utah
- Bankruptcy and Creditor Debtor Rights / Insolvency and Reorganization Law
- Litigation - Bankruptcy
Current Firm: Lon A. Jenkins, Chapter 13 Trustee
Education: University of Utah, J.D., graduated 1983
Location: Salt Lake City, UT
